Questlove is being censored [FULL STORY]

After getting scolded by NBC for this Michele Bachman stunt, Questlove is being forced to submit all song choices for approval. Unfortunately, this meant he was unable to play “He Blinded Me With Science” for Katie Holmes, as well as “It’s Raining Men” for Tom Cruise (probably).

Sinead O’Connor got married in Vegas

Following her Twitter campaign for a lover last September, Sinead O’Connor tied the knot with her partner, Barry Herridge, at a drive-thru chapel in Las Vegas just yesterday.
